What Goes Into a New Boiler Installation

The boiler itself sits in the basement or mechanical room and is the heart of the system. A contractor installs the heat exchanger, burner assembly, and pressure vessel together as a single unit. Supply and return pipes run out from the boiler to carry heated water through the rest of the house.
The expansion tank mounts near the boiler and absorbs pressure changes as water heats and cools. The circulator pump, also near the boiler, pushes water through the loop. Thermostats or zone valves go in at the living spaces, giving each area its own point of control.

Licensing and Legal Requirements in Swift County, Minnesota
Minnesota defines a mechanical contractor as a business that installs, repairs or maintains heating, ventilating, cooling or refrigeration systems — the definition that carries the exemption from the residential contractor licence.
Minnesota's residential contractor licence does not reach HVAC work: the licensing section carries its own exemption list, and a mechanical contractor is exempt from the licence requirement by name.
